Background

GSK plc is a global healthcare company headquartered in London, UK. The company operates in three primary business sectors: Pharmaceuticals, Vaccines, and Consumer Healthcare. Its shares are publicly traded on the New York Stock Exchange under the ticker symbol GSK.

The Lawsuit

The securities class action lawsuit alleges that GSK failed to disclose material information regarding the safety and efficacy of its drugs, leading to misrepresentations and false statements made to investors. Impact on Individual Investors

If the allegations in the lawsuit are proven true, investors who bought GSK securities during the specified time frame may be able to recover their losses. The recovery process involves filing a claim form and providing documentation of their purchases. A securities class action settlement would distribute damages to eligible claimants, who would then receive a payment based on their individual losses.

Impact on the World

The outcome of this lawsuit could have significant implications for the pharmaceutical industry and investor confidence. If GSK is found liable for securities fraud, it could face hefty fines, regulatory scrutiny, and reputational damage. This, in turn, could lead to increased transparency and accountability in the industry, as other companies may be incentivized to provide more accurate and complete information to investors.
